WORLD CHAMPIONSHIP 5 PINS INDIVIDUAL LADIES

Published on: November 10, 2023


 

Hall in Tirol November 12th 2023.

Daniela Romiti won and with this she will always be the holder of the first 5 PINS Women's World Championships.
Hall in Tirol the place, on November 12, 2023 the date, an enthusiastic public celebrated and cheered the Italian player who beat her compatriot Cristina Pulcini 3-1, who accumulated great tension during the competition and whose happiness shone with her silver medalist, Charlotte Koefoed from Denmark and Lucía Bionlillo from Italy completed a podium that would go down in billiard history.
It was a special world championship that had the recognition of the public who also showed a higher level than expected.

Hall in Tirol , November 11th 2023.

 

The Ladies five-Pins world championship took off in Hall in Tirol with nerves that were transformed into excitement both due to the equality of the majority of the matches and the quality developed by the participants.

Twelve players who open a path and a new era for the five Pins monopolized the public and the expectation for tomorrow's day.
